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
826969666 102 942258067 39579252318 0626
24977 01720123678
24977 01720123678
462311992 32 19
All about undefined
Interested in learning more?
24977 01720123678
462311992 32 19
See more
18506237759 1475387683 16370461
386991257 5654244792 494
See more
30143 462
3395279713 082 99560842034 51 86784
See more